"ELITEKEY (pronounced el-li-dey-geh) is the Micmac word for 'I fashion things'. The book documents five centuries of Micmac material culture, ranging in time from the period before contact with Europeans to the present day. A history and technical explanation is given for crafts in the following areas: costume and decorative techniques; birchbark work; porcupine quillwork on birchbark; work in wood, bone, stone and natural fibres; and the art of basketry.".

Account of excavations of the glass works in Trenton, Nova Scotia, with brief histories of the various glass houses and Nova Scotia's glassmaking industry in general.
